art group insurance is a specialized form of coverage designed to meet the unique needs of artists and art organizations. From painters and sculptors to galleries and art schools, this type of insurance can provide financial protection in the event of accidents, theft, or other unforeseen circumstances.

One of the key benefits of art group insurance is that it can cover a variety of risks that are specific to the art world. For example, many policies include coverage for damage to artwork during transport or while on display in a gallery. This can be particularly important for artists who rely on their work to generate income, as even minor damage can lead to significant financial losses.

Additionally, art group insurance can provide protection for valuable collections of artwork. Whether you are a collector or a gallery owner, having insurance coverage for your pieces can offer peace of mind knowing that your investment is protected. In the event of theft or damage, your policy can help to cover the cost of repairs or replacement, allowing you to continue showcasing your work without fear of financial ruin.

Another important aspect of art group insurance is liability coverage. This type of policy can protect artists and organizations from legal claims arising from accidents or injuries that occur on their premises. For example, if a visitor slips and falls in your gallery, your liability insurance can help cover their medical expenses and any legal fees that may result from a lawsuit.

In addition to financial protection, art group insurance can also provide access to valuable resources and support. Many insurance providers offer risk management services to help artists and organizations identify and mitigate potential risks to their work. This can include tips on proper storage and handling of artwork, as well as guidance on how to protect yourself from copyright infringement or other legal issues.

Furthermore, some art group insurance policies include coverage for events such as art fairs and exhibitions. These can be lucrative opportunities for artists to showcase their work and connect with potential buyers, but they also come with their own set of risks. Having the right insurance coverage in place can help ensure that you are protected in the event of a mishap during a show or sale.
